**Q: What gates a canary promotion in Drexhall Deploy?**

Promotion requires three checks: signed build artifacts verified against the Nimbright registry, error-budget burn below threshold for four hours, and no open critical findings from the scanner. Manual overrides are logged and require two approvers, neither of whom may be the change author. The full gate definitions and audit trail format are documented internally.

runbook for tafof-yawif: https://confluence.tolvaqsys.internal/display/display/browse/pages/7be3

### Step 7 — Repoint the assignment service

During this migration window, the Farlane experiment assignment service switches from the legacy bucket map to the new deterministic hasher. Assignments made before the switch remain sticky; only new subjects are hashed under the new scheme. If you see a spike in cross-bucket movement, pause the rollout and page the experimentation channel. Before restarting the service, confirm it is running with the settings listed below.

settings of fafog-haduf:
ZORIX_PIN=4648
ZORIX_METRICS_HOST=metrics.zorix.paliqsys.corp
ZORIX_LOG_LEVEL=info
ZORIX_TENANT=druix

/*
 * EXIF scrubber client setup — discussed at weekly eng sync.
 * This client sends uploaded images to the Plateglass scrubbing
 * service, which strips GPS coordinates, device serials, and
 * timestamps before anything touches the Lantermere CDN. Note the
 * scrubber is synchronous; uploads block until it responds, so the
 * timeout here (4s) matters. Retries are capped at two to avoid
 * double-scrubbing artifacts. The client authenticates with the
 * internal service key on the next line.
 */

API key for yahig-tadup: kto7_ubizbYm